Understanding The Importance Of EN 166 Standard In Safety Eyewear

In the world of safety eyewear, the EN 166 standard plays a crucial role in ensuring the protection of the wearer’s eyes It is a European standard that sets out the requirements for personal eye protection, including safety glasses, goggles, and face shields This standard specifies the minimum requirements for optical properties, impact resistance, and other key characteristics that safety eyewear must meet to provide adequate protection in various working environments.

The EN 166 standard covers a wide range of safety eyewear, from basic safety glasses to more specialized goggles and face shields One of the key elements of this standard is the requirement for optical clarity and distortion-free vision Safety eyewear that meets the EN 166 standard must provide clear and undistorted vision to the wearer, ensuring that they can see clearly and perform their tasks safely.

Another important aspect of the EN 166 standard is impact resistance Safety eyewear must be able to withstand the impact of high-speed particles and flying debris without breaking or shattering This is crucial in a wide range of industries, including construction, manufacturing, and healthcare, where workers are exposed to potential eye hazards on a daily basis.

The EN 166 standard also sets out requirements for the materials used in safety eyewear The lenses and frames must be made from durable materials that can withstand the rigors of daily use They must also be resistant to scratches and chemicals, ensuring that they remain in good condition for an extended period of time.

One of the key benefits of safety eyewear that meets the EN 166 standard is the added protection it provides against UV radiation Many safety glasses and goggles are equipped with UV protection, shielding the wearer’s eyes from harmful UV rays that can cause long-term damage en 166. This is particularly important for outdoor workers who are exposed to the sun for extended periods.

In addition to protecting against UV radiation, safety eyewear that meets the EN 166 standard can also provide protection against other hazards, such as liquid splashes, dust, and impact injuries Goggles and face shields that conform to this standard offer full-face protection, ensuring that the wearer’s eyes, face, and surrounding areas are shielded from potential harm.
